Go to Post I am committed to this program because I know it works. It gets more students (than the school average) into college, it makes better adults of the students we mentor, it makes better employees of the mentors that participate, and it makes better schools in our communities. - Al Skierkiewicz [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 23-05-2006, 06:28
dani dani is offline
Junior Member
FLL #0002
 
Join Date: May 2006
Location: Pakistan
Posts: 1
dani is an unknown quantity at this point
ADXRS150 turn rate controller help required...

Hi all,

I am working to make a angular turn rate controller for Radio Controlled aircraft. The main requirnment for this task is that rc aircraft should not go into unsafe bank which is actually when an aircraft turns too quick i.e. it complete 360 degrees in less than 2 min. the 2 minute turn is safe but less then this will cause aircraft to be in unsafe bank.

For this i am using ADXRS150EB the gyro from analogdevices.com. But unfortunately I am not able to figure out the correct priciple of a turn rate control therefore i couldnt write the correct code for this. So is there some one who can help me regading using ADXRS150EB for making a turn rate control for an RC aircraft.

Regards.
Dani
  #2   Spotlight this post!  
Unread 23-05-2006, 09:04
Donut Donut is offline
The Arizona Mentor
AKA: Andrew
FRC #2662 (RoboKrew)
Team Role: Engineer
 
Join Date: Mar 2005
Rookie Year: 2004
Location: Goodyear, AZ
Posts: 1,307
Donut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ond reputeDonut has a reputation beyond repute
Re: ADXRS150 turn rate controller help required...

The ADXRS150EB has a sensitivity of 12.5mV/°/s and reads the turning rate of itself, so to ensure that the aircraft does not turn too fast, you should just need to read the value of the gyro and then compare it to a limit on speed. For example, if you wanted to make sure to never turn faster than 20°/s, you would just read the value of the gyro and make sure it is not more than 250mV over or under 2.5V (which is typically the voltage when stationary of the gyro, you might want to test it and find out what yours is though).
  #3   Spotlight this post!  
Unread 23-05-2006, 11:18
KenWittlief KenWittlief is offline
.
no team
Team Role: Engineer
 
Join Date: Mar 2003
Location: Rochester, NY
Posts: 4,213
Ken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ond reputeKenWittlief has a reputation beyond repute
Re: ADXRS150 turn rate controller help required...

A model RC / Hobby plane would have no trouble turning 360° in 2 minutes - it would have no trouble doing a 360 in 10 seconds (Ive been flying RC planes for 30 years)

but an auton RC plane with a heavy payload would have to turn slowly to avoid stalling its wings.

BTW, no offense intended but I'm a little leery assisting someone in Pakistan to design a control system for an autonomous RC aircraft. I don't know how many RC hobbyists there are in Pakistan, but I do know of other people in that part of the world who are very interested in autonomous aircraft!

EDIT: Im already taking a lot of (red) flack for my post in this thread - Its my opinion that we should not help anonymous first time posters who live on the boarder of a war zone to design autonomous aircraft.

Sorry if I come across as a jerk, but in this case I prefer to err on the side of common sense!

Last edited by KenWittlief : 23-05-2006 at 14:51.
  #4   Spotlight this post!  
Unread 23-05-2006, 13:16
Joe Johnson's Avatar Unsung FIRST Hero
Joe Johnson Joe Johnson is offline
Engineer at Medrobotics
AKA: Dr. Joe
FRC #0088 (TJ2)
Team Role: Engineer
 
Join Date: May 2001
Rookie Year: 1996
Location: Raynham, MA
Posts: 2,648
Joe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ond reputeJoe Johnson has a reputation beyond repute
Re: ADXRS150 turn rate controller help required...

Quote:
Originally Posted by KenWittlief
...
BTW, no offense intended but I'm a little leery assisting someone in Pakistan to design a control system for an autonomous RC aircraft....
I think this comment plays into many stereo types that I think are largely undeserved.

Also, even if the concern was valid, this seems to me to be a pretty pathetic attempt to gather info.

Using Pakistan in his/her profile (I apologize for now knowing if Dani is a masculine or feminine name) is sort of a silly thing to do if one is trying to get access to sensitive data.

Beyond this, there are full blown, very well developed open source projects on inertial guidance (including How To's and Source Code!) available to anyone in the world with access to Google.

Even more, if you have access to Tower Hobby or 1000 other hobbyist websites, there are off the shelve solutions to autonomously fly RC airplanes.

There are a lot of things to fear in this world and a lot of people that might be good to question under the influence of Veritaserum But I doubt that Dani belongs on either list.

Callin' 'em as I see 'em...

Joe J.
__________________
Joseph M. Johnson, Ph.D., P.E.
Mentor
Team #88, TJ2

Last edited by Joe Johnson : 23-05-2006 at 13:25.
  #5   Spotlight this post!  
Unread 23-05-2006, 13:50
Matt Krass's Avatar
Matt Krass Matt Krass is offline
"Old" and Cranky. Get off my lawn!
AKA: Dark Ages
FRC #0263 (Sachem Aftershock)
Team Role: Mentor
 
Join Date: Oct 2002
Rookie Year: 2002
Location: Long Island, NY
Posts: 1,187
Matt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ond reputeMatt Krass has a reputation beyond repute
Send a message via AIM to Matt Krass
Re: ADXRS150 turn rate controller help required...

Quote:
Originally Posted by KenWittlief
SNIP!

BTW, no offense intended but I'm a little leery assisting someone in Pakistan to design a control system for an autonomous RC aircraft. I don't know how many RC hobbyists there are in Pakistan, but I do know of other people in that part of the world who are very interested in autonomous aircraft!

Well that was uhh...rude.

As far as turn rate goes, if you can use a more sensitive gyro with a slower maximum turn rate, that will also help. Or perhaps (I'm not an EE here (yet ) so bear with me) using an opamp to amplify the signal and make it a little cleaner?
__________________
Matt Krass
If I suggest something to try and fix a problem, and you don't understand what I mean, please PM me!

I'm a FIRST relic of sorts, I remember when we used PBASIC and we got CH Flightsticks in the KoP. In my day we didn't have motorized carts, we pushed our robots uphill, both ways! (Houston 2003!)
  #6   Spotlight this post!  
Unread 23-05-2006, 14:55
Madison's Avatar
Madison Madison is offline
Dancing through life...
FRC #0488 (Xbot)
Team Role: Engineer
 
Join Date: Jun 2001
Rookie Year: 1999
Location: Seattle, WA
Posts: 5,244
Madison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ond reputeMadison has a reputation beyond repute
Re: ADXRS150 turn rate controller help required...

Quote:
Originally Posted by KenWittlief
Sorry if I come across as a jerk, but in this case I prefer to err on the side of common sense!
It's a pretty sad day when anyone thinks they can pass racism off as common sense, Ken. You should be ashamed of yourself.
__________________
--Madison--

...down at the Ozdust!

Like a grand and miraculous spaceship, our planet has sailed through the universe of time. And for a brief moment, we have been among its many passengers.
  #7   Spotlight this post!  
Unread 23-05-2006, 14:59
Katie Reynolds Katie Reynolds is offline
Registered User
no team (NEW Apple Corps)
Team Role: Alumni
 
Join Date: Nov 2001
Rookie Year: 2001
Location: Appleton, WI, USA
Posts: 2,598
Katie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ond reputeKatie Reynolds has a reputation beyond repute
Send a message via AIM to Katie Reynolds Send a message via Yahoo to Katie Reynolds
Re: ADXRS150 turn rate controller help required...

Closing this before it gets out of hand.

Dani, I believe Donut answered your question.
__________________
Team #93 - NEW Apple Corps
Student - 2001-2004
Team #857 - Superior Roboworks
Mentor - 2006-2009
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
ADXRS150 gyro yaw rate sensor Brian M. Electrical 13 17-10-2004 02:28
EduBot Help, RC Controller Allison K Robotics Education and Curriculum 5 29-03-2004 16:48
ADXRS150/300 Sensor m0rph3us Electrical 2 06-02-2004 22:37
Help On Coding 2K1 Controller GregTheGreat Programming 9 05-12-2003 18:35
Help - Gear Motor Controller dteshome Motors 17 13-05-2003 15:13


All times are GMT -5. The time now is 23:05.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i